After a short stop-over (passengers do not de-board), when we're ready to head back to Santa Fe, the brakeman/woman rides the caboose, and the engine "shoves" all the cars up the track. The train ride to the scenic overlook is about 45 minutes to one hour each way. We run this train year-round on Sundays, and also on Wednesdays from May through October. Snacks, hot and cold drinks, as well as stronger stuff is available at our cash bar (small bills, please).
